ABSTRACT

The question of understanding hinges on an unannounced though nonetheless ineliminable doubling within giving (a doubling beyond simplicity and therefore other than a simple addition). The move away from simplicity means that the difficult element here-a difficulty based on complexity-is that part of this doubling has to be thought as work and thus as an original reworking; one in the end signalling the effective presence of the anoriginal. The work involved can be provisionally identified as that which is marked out by the name Nachträglichkeit. (The question of Nachträglichkeit must at this stage still remain a question. Its provisional designation of the interplay of repetition and identity articulated within the complex temporal relationship of the retroactive and the making present-presencing-will itself come to be opened up, an opening which-as with what is named within it-is only explicable in terms of work.) Moreover one of the inevitable consequences of the anoriginal will be the centrality of work.
